Helpis foelixi

Helpis foelixi is a jumping spider ( that is, a member of the Salticidae family), first described in 2014 by Marek Zabka and Barbara Patoleta,[1][2] from a male specimen only.

[2] The species epithet, foelixi, honours the Swiss arachnologist, Rainer F.

Foelix.

[2] It is known only from the holotype site at the edge of Lake Poona, Cooloola Queensland.
